Edna Alvenia Schoelerman, 75, of Everly, a 4-H leader a a member of the Farm Bureau Women, died Wednesday at Spencer Municipal Hospital
The daughter of August and Mary (Schumacher) Wede, was born July 25, 1908 in Moneta. She was raised in Lakefield, Minnesota, until she was 15, at which time her family moved to Everly where she attended school
She married Art Schoelerman, June 1, 1927, at Spencer. After their marriage, they farmed south of Everly until 1962, at which time they moved into the town of Everly
Mrs. Schoelerman was a member of Hope Lutheran Church of Everly, the Hope Lutheran Ladies Aid, worked as a 4-H leader and was a member of the Farm Bureau Women
Survivors include her husband, two sons, Don Schoelerman and Jack Schoelerman, both of Royal; one daughter, Janis Hilbert of Holyoke, Colorado; and ten grandchildren
Services will be Saturday at 10:30 a.m. at Hope Lutheran Church in Everly. The Rev. Roger Hanson will officiate.
Burial will be in Lone tree Cemetery, Everly
The Warner Funeral Home of Spencer is in charge of arrangements
Spencer Daily Reporter, Spencer, Clay County, Iowa, March 16, 1984
